| Index: src/interpreter/bytecode-peephole-optimizer.cc
|
| diff --git a/src/interpreter/bytecode-peephole-optimizer.cc b/src/interpreter/bytecode-peephole-optimizer.cc
|
| index dc2d33b2ede6695aaac1719098e362217f595ee4..0f18d1b8c1053a1a3dd7f51cef53c9f2ea34453b 100644
|
| --- a/src/interpreter/bytecode-peephole-optimizer.cc
|
| +++ b/src/interpreter/bytecode-peephole-optimizer.cc
|
| @@ -201,10 +201,10 @@ void TransformLdaStarToLdrLdar(Bytecode new_bytecode, BytecodeNode* const last,
|
| bool BytecodePeepholeOptimizer::ChangeLdaToLdr(BytecodeNode* const current) {
|
| if (current->bytecode() == Bytecode::kStar) {
|
| switch (last_.bytecode()) {
|
| - case Bytecode::kLoadIC:
|
| + case Bytecode::kLdaNamedProperty:
|
| TransformLdaStarToLdrLdar(Bytecode::kLdrNamedProperty, &last_, current);
|
| return true;
|
| - case Bytecode::kKeyedLoadIC:
|
| + case Bytecode::kLdaKeyedProperty:
|
| TransformLdaStarToLdrLdar(Bytecode::kLdrKeyedProperty, &last_, current);
|
| return true;
|
| case Bytecode::kLdaGlobal:
|
|
|